approvals, denials and payments. We have contacted them to obtain
information on the repair claim you have referenced. Per ***, your claim was denied because you did not get authorization from *** that the repairs were covered before having the repairs performed. Your contract clearly stated at the bottom of every page starting on page 1 of 15 "NO CLAIMS WILL BE PAID WITHOUT PRIOR AUTHORIZATION. CALL ###-###-#### or ###-###-####" We have attached a copy of your contract for your convenience.Further review of the claim and Invoice shows the failed components are Camshaft VVT solenoids and the contract does not have coverage for these components. A list of covered components can be found in Section B of your attached contract.

I have been with CarShield since august of 2021 paying $109.00 a month. My car broke down in June 2,2023, it turns out the engine is gone because of the pistons, CarShield doesn’t cover pistons; they told me to authorize a complete tear down of the engine to find the cause of the broken pistons, that cost me $1200.00. CarShield would reimburse if they cover the cost of the engine repair. Mechanic let carShield know the valves were bad which caused the failure. Carshield agreed to fix engine, they were getting the parts to fix it. They then called mechanic and said carbon buildup caused the valves to go bad and they don’t cover carbon build up, so my claim was denied. After four weeks of waiting and going back and forth with Carshield they decided not to cover the repair. I am out of $1200.00 for tear down and now have to pay $6200.00 for new engine. The mechanic will no longer do business with carshield. They told mechanic he didn’t have to take engine out of car to find the problem. CarShield will find any reason not to cover the cost even though they told me it was covered.Business Response
